Technical Specifications

Side-by-side comparison of Pentium E5800 and Athlon II X2 250e

Intel

Pentium E5800

The Pentium E5800 is manufactured by Intel. It was released in 28 November 2010 (15 years ago). It is based on the Wolfdale (2008−2010) architecture. It features 2 cores and 2 threads. Base frequency is 3.2 GHz, with boost up to 3.2 GHz. L3 cache: 0 kB. L2 cache: 2 MB (total). Built on 45 nm process technology. Socket: LGA775. Thermal design power (TDP): 65 Watt. Memory support: DDR1, DDR2, DDR3. Passmark benchmark score: 1,190 points. Launch price was $68.

AMD

Athlon II X2 250e

The Athlon II X2 250e is manufactured by AMD. It was released in 21 September 2010 (15 years ago). It is based on the Regor (2009−2013) architecture. It features 2 cores and 2 threads. Base frequency is 3 GHz, with boost up to 3 GHz. L3 cache: 0 kB. L2 cache: 1 MB. Built on 45 nm process technology. Socket: AM3. Thermal design power (TDP): 45 Watt. Memory support: DDR3. Passmark benchmark score: 1,202 points. Launch price was $77.

Processing Power

Both the Pentium E5800 and Athlon II X2 250e share an identical 2-core/2-thread configuration. Boost clocks reach 3.2 GHz on the Pentium E5800 versus 3 GHz on the Athlon II X2 250e — a 6.5% clock advantage for the Pentium E5800 (base: 3.2 GHz vs 3 GHz). The Pentium E5800 uses the Wolfdale (2008−2010) architecture (45 nm), while the Athlon II X2 250e uses Regor (2009−2013) (45 nm). In PassMark, the Pentium E5800 scores 1,190 against the Athlon II X2 250e's 1,202 — a 1% lead for the Athlon II X2 250e. Both processors carry 0 kB of L3 cache.
